加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(http://www.zzredu.com/)- 应用程序、AI行业应用、CDN、低代码、区块链!
当前位置: 首页 > 综合聚焦 > 移动互联 > 应用 > 正文

跨平台开发与离线缓存优化实战

发布时间:2025-12-02 08:29:59 所属栏目:应用 来源:DaWei
导读:  在小程序原生开发中,跨平台开发已经成为提升效率的重要手段。通过使用Taro、Uniapp等框架,我们可以在一套代码基础上适配微信、支付宝、百度等多个平台。然而,跨平台开发不仅仅是代码复用的问题,还需要关注各

  在小程序原生开发中,跨平台开发已经成为提升效率的重要手段。通过使用Taro、Uniapp等框架,我们可以在一套代码基础上适配微信、支付宝、百度等多个平台。然而,跨平台开发不仅仅是代码复用的问题,还需要关注各平台的特性差异和性能表现。


  在实际项目中,我们常常遇到页面加载速度慢、接口响应延迟等问题。为了解决这些问题,离线缓存机制显得尤为重要。通过本地存储策略,可以有效减少网络请求次数,提升用户体验。


  在实现离线缓存时,需要合理设计缓存策略。例如,对于静态数据可以设置较长的缓存时间,而对于动态数据则需要根据业务需求进行更新控制。同时,要处理好缓存过期与数据一致性的关系,避免因缓存导致的数据错误。


  缓存数据的存储方式也需要考虑。小程序支持localStorage和StorageSync等方法,但需要注意存储大小限制和读写性能。对于较大的数据集,建议采用分块存储或压缩处理,以优化存储效率。


  在跨平台开发中,还需要注意不同平台对API的支持差异。例如,某些API在微信小程序中可用,但在其他平台可能不支持。因此,在编写代码时,需要做好条件判断和兼容性处理,确保功能在所有目标平台上正常运行。


2025建议图AI生成,仅供参考

  测试是确保跨平台与缓存机制稳定的关键环节。建议在不同设备和网络环境下进行全面测试,发现并修复潜在问题。只有经过充分验证的方案,才能真正提升小程序的性能和用户体验。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章